    Lampranthus sociorum old capsules

    Lampranthus sociorum old capsules
    Author: Ivan Lätti
    Photographer: Judd Kirkel Welwitch

    The old Lampranthus sociorum fruit capsules in picture may or may not still have seeds remaining in them.

    When the capsules start off young, they bulging on top, pinkish red and fleshy. Five lines or folds show the valve margins clearly radiating from the centre. The sepal lobes gradually blacken, dry and disappear, the base of the calyx a yellowish cup holding the fruit inners until it hardens into the woody seed container.

    As for all, life is about becoming over time, in accordance with a particular, genetically determined programme holding firm for the species (Smith, et al, 1998; Bond and Goldblatt, 1984; iNaturalist).
